Well if you were to walk around
in this upper level here, you'd probably find somewhere
in the neighborhood, I'm really just estimating this, probably about 7,000 games and I'd say that because
there's everything from Pong to PlayStation four here and
in a lot of cases we have duplicates because some
titles are very popular but if you go into the
storage area downstairs, you're probably in that
25 to 30,000 games area
